Healthy glowy skin

If your skin is dry and dull, aim for products that gives you glow and a dewy finish. If your skin is oily and shiny, aim for products that are oil free and minimizes pores. You need a primer to keep your makeup in place, a foundation or tinted moisturiser will even out your skintone.

Brighten your under eye area to make your eyes look bigger and more awake, this will also make your face appear younger and more youthful. Don’t apply the under eye concealer under your whole eye, but focus it on where you actually have a darker colour which is normally just in the inner corners and down like shown in the picture below. Don’t forget to set the under eye concealer with a lightreflecting concealer powder, this will prevent creasing throughout the day. An under eye concealer like the Touche Eclat can be used for so much more which can have dramatic effect on your face if you know how to use it.

Applying a hint of a more shimmery highlighter to the cheek bones will enhance those modelesque high cheekbones and give your face more structure. A little goes a long way, I like to apply it just on the top of the cheekbones. If you have very oily skin you should stay away from shimmery products and use a light matte product instead like a foundation in a lighter shade than your skin.

 Pink Cheeks

A flush of pink in the cheeks is what gives the innocent fresh look. Be sure you place it in a flattering way for your face shape. Creams works really well for dry/normal skin and will look more natural on the skin, whilst powder blushes are more suitable for oily skin as they will stay put longer.
